KARACHI: (Dunya News) – Sindh government has on Monday released Rs 50 million for the treatment of the student allegedly disabled by torture at Larkana Cadet College, reported Dunya News.

According to details, the student named Muhammad Ahmad had allegedly been vandalised by his teacher. Sindh government said that Ahmad would be sent to United States for treatment and all the expenses will be borne by Sindh government.

The notification says that Muhammad Ahmad’s travel expenses will also be borne by Sindh government.
